About the issue
This common payroll error develops while downloading or installing payroll
updates in the software. An unstable internet connection during the update
process is one significant condition that encourages this error to develop.
QuickBooks needs to be continuously connected to the internet during the
update. If the connection is experiencing lapses in between, then the payroll
update process will stop, and you’ll receive an error message on your screen,
after which it is possible for the software to crash or freeze for some time.
Reasons
The potential causes of this payroll update error in QuickBooks are given below-
• The TLS settings are not allowing QuickBooks to establish a connection with
the internet.
• QuickBooks is getting blocked by security software running on your
computer.
• QuickBooks has developed some internal issues due to a defective
installation of your PC earlier.
Solutions
The methods that can be used to eliminate this issue from QuickBooks are given
below-
Solution 1- Configure the TLS settings on your Windows
TLS stands for Transport Layer Security; it is a protocol that ensures the safety
of your PC while it is connected to the internet. All the data uploaded on the
internet is encrypted to protect it from threats, and the TLS protocol even
protects the PC from threats that can enter the system through the internet.
Follow the steps given below to configure the TLS settings-
• Open the Run window by pressing Windows + R on your keyboard.
• Type inetcpl.cpl as a command to open Internet Properties.
• Go to the Advanced tab and click Settings.
• Scroll down in the list to find TLS settings.
• Enable TLS 1.2 by marking the checkbox alongside it.
• Click on Apply, then Ok.
• Try to update again in QuickBooks.
If there are still issues present, try the next method.
Solution 2- Utilize the QuickBooks Tool hub.
Repairing minor issues in the software can be done using QuickBooks Tool tub.
Ensure you keep the latest version of QuickBooks Tool hub on your computer
and refer to the steps given below-
1. Open QuickBooks Tool hub.
2. Click on Program Problems and tap Quick fix my program.
3. Wait for the process to finish & reopen QuickBooks.
4. The payroll update issues will be fixed after using these methods.
